Because my printer is in a corner of my workbench that is partially blocked by a storage shelf and the outer wall, I installed this on my Creality Ender 5. With this cable, I was able to move the control head display all the way around the front left of the printer, making it easier to adjust settings and start/stop prints. I also printed a box to mount the control head so I wouldn't have to worry about it shorting out on my workbench. br>br>Note that this cable is not shielded and was picking up electromagnetic interference from the Ender and another 3d printer next to the extended control head, causing the control head button to click at random. When current is passed through to heat the hotend or bed, the problem becomes even worse. As suggested on an online forum, I wrapped this ribbon cable in aluminum foil to help solve the clicking problem by blocking EMI. This happened on the very short factory cable as well, indicating that the problem is not with the cable itself, but rather with Creality's poor grounding and/or shielding.
